Uncovering Profitable Niches With Precision


Precise niche identification increases FBA profitability by strategically locating market segments with quantifiable demand, limited saturation, and high revenue potential.

You utilize Data Dive to speed up niche identification by reviewing segmented search volume, competition density, and conversion rates. Targeting subcategories like “eco-friendly food storage” or “BPA-free lunch boxes” demonstrates this process, as you evaluate validated metrics—like 11,000 monthly searches and under 250 competing ASINs—while monitoring seasonality and market trends.

The platform’s algorithms speedily evaluate pricing history, review velocity, and fulfillment options, ensuring product-market fit. Simplifying Complex Data for Smarter Decision-Making


When you analyze FBA product data, simplifying multivariate datasets allows for faster, evidence-based decisions that directly impact product launch outcomes.

Data visualization tools, such as heatmaps, scatter plots, and bar charts, change raw figures into easily interpretable formats.

Decision frameworks—like Eisenhower matrices and weighted scoring models—organize variables including sales velocity, review counts, and price competition into structured processes. These frameworks rigorously evaluate product options, lowering cognitive load and misinterpretation risks.

Through showing sales rank movements or price trends visually, you’ll identify anomalies and correlations immediately.
